We are seeking a compassionate and qualified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to provide school-based services for students in a K–12 educational setting. The SLP will work closely with students, families, teachers, and multidisciplinary teams to support communication development and academic success.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ct speech and language evaluations for students
  • Develop, implement, and monitor Individualized Education Programs (IEPs)
  • Provide direct and indirect speech-language therapy services
  • Support students with articulation, fluency, voice, expressive/receptive language, and social communication needs
  • Maintain accurate documentation, progress reports, and compliance records
  • Collaborate with teachers, administrators, parents, and special education teams
  • Participate in IEP meetings and multidisciplinary team meetings
  • Monitor student progress and adjust therapy plans as needed
  • Utilize evidence-based practices and assistive technology when appropriate
  • Promote student engagement, participation, and communication confidence

Qualifications

  • Master’s Degree in Speech-Language Pathology
  • Active state SLP license and/or Department of Education certification
  • Previous school-based or pediatric experience preferred
  • Strong communication, organization, and collaboration skills
